Position Overview
Power your future with Qualus as a Senior Project Manager on our Engineering team. The Senior Project Manager at Qualus is responsible for leading and managing advisory, engineering, engineer-procure (EP), and engineer-procure-construct (EPC) projects with a focus on high-voltage electrical substations, transmission lines, telecommunications, renewable energy (solar, geothermal, wind), electric utilities and large load industrial projects. This includes managing all activities related to project scope, schedule, cost/budget, quality, communications, resources, procurement, and risk elements to optimize client service, quality and financial performance on large, complex and challenging projects. This role also involves cross-disciplinary coordination, client relationship management, and mentoring junior staff. Occasional travel, including overnight stays, is required.
Responsibilities
- The Senior Project Manager will lead and manage complex engineering projects across substation design, transmission, telecommunications, renewable energy interconnections, electric utilities and large load industrial facilities.
- Work with project teams including engineers, designers, and subcontractors in the coordination of project documents and drawings, ensuring schedules are met.
- Manage project scope, budget, scheduling, and change control throughout the project lifecycle.
- Support procurement and construction activities, including managing site construction managers and procurement teams.
- Establish and maintain professional relationships with our external business partners.
- Support proposal development including scope definition, cost estimating, schedule creation, and vendor quote evaluation.
- Coordinate overall conceptual design plans in the initial development phase of large load, renewable energy and battery storage projects specific to utility interconnections and/or non-grid connections.
- Coordinate environmental permitting and land rights as needed with clients, agencies and staff.
- Assist clients with competitive bidding processes for steel structures, long lead electrical equipment and substation construction activities.
- Mentor less experienced staff on a wide range of technical and project management best practices and competencies.
- Participate in internal process improvements and help to develop Qualus's project control systems and standards.
- Work with large load developers, renewable energy developers and other clients with support specific to schedules and cost estimates.
- Prepare and maintain project schedules as needed and coordinate with team members and clients on schedule impacts.
- Track budgets, prepare regular project status reports, and conduct team/client meetings.
- Generally, keep management appraised of project status and report as needed to clients, agencies, and team members. This often includes facilitating monthly or bi-weekly team meetings and issuing meeting notes
- Occasional travel (1–2 times per month) with overnight stays required.

Qualus is a leading pure-play power solutions firm and innovator at the forefront of power infrastructure transformation, with differentiated capabilities across grid modernization, resiliency, security, and sustainability. The firm partners with utilities, commercial, industrial, data center, and government clients, and renewable and energy storage developers, offering comprehensive solutions through boutique and integrated advisory, planning, engineering, digital solutions, program management, energy efficiency and specialized field services. Qualus also provides software and technology enabled services and develops breakthrough solutions for critical power industry challenges such as distributed and variable resource integration, emergency management, and secure data exchange. The firm has over 2,000 professionals, with offices throughout the U.S. and Canada.
